Data SourcesInset maps based on:T he images cover the Calheta and Funchal location (starting date of fire 08.08.2016) andconsist of:SP O T 06/07 © CN ES (2016), distributed by Airbus DS., acquired on 12 and 16.08.2016(after), G SD 1.5 m, ~ 20% cloud coverage, as well as of, P LEIADES © CN ES (2015),distributed by Airbus DS., acquired on 17 and 23.07.2015 (before), G SD 0.5 m, 0% cloudcoverage, all provided under CO P ERN ICU S by the European U nion and ESA, all rightsreserved.Reference Imagery: O rthophotos © DRO T A - Direção Regional do O rdenamento doT erritório e Ambiente, Color, RG B, G SD 0.4 m, 2010, aerial photos.Vector layers: Road N etwork and Buildings Footprints © DRO T A, duly updated/ digitiz ed, onthe basis the satellite imagery | Elevation data – Digital T errain Model, 10m © DRO TA |Census data © IN E 2011 | CO SRAM 2007 © DRO T A, duly updated/refined on the basis ofthe satellite data photointerpretation.
Map ProductionT he map shows the fire damage delineation and grading for the area of interest. T he gradingclasses are (i) N ot Burnt, (ii) P artly Burnt and (iii) H eavily Burnt. Damage delineation wasbased on thresholding of the N DV I and differential N DV I (dN DV I) spectral indices derivedfrom the pre-fire and post fire V H R image acquisitions. T hresholding levels for each damagegrade class were based on a supervised approach.T he estimated geometric accuracy of the images is 2.5 m, from native positional accuracy ofthe back ground satellite image, compliant with JRC requirements for 1:10,000 cartography.T he estimated thematic accuracy of this product is 85% or better, based on internal validationprocedures and visual interpretation of recogniz able items on very high resolution opticalimagery.T he statistical table included in the map shows the areas (vegetation cover) affected per firedamage grading category.
Map InformationT he purpose of the requested mapping is to generate comprehensive knowledge at a postdisaster phase, referring to forest fire incidents during the summer of 2016 in Madeira island.T he analysis refers to two individual sites; Calheta and Funchal.T he assessment includes damage delineation and grading, considering three damageclasses (not burnt, partly burnt and heavily burnt). Moreover, towards adequate disasterpreparedness and efficient support of informed decision mak ing concerning planning andrecovery activities of the involved stak eholders, evaluation (potential / extent) of occurrenceof landslides secondary risk was also carried out on the basis of the post-event situation.T he k ey user of the map series is the Serviço Regional de P roteção Civil, IP - RegiãoAutonoma da Madeira, P ortugal.

Consequences within the AOI: Calheta
LULC Not burnt (ha) Partly burnt (ha) Heavily burnt (ha)Agricul tura l a reas - 11,31 270,99Broad-leaved fores t - 195,66 557,57Coni ferous fores t - 48,53 320,58Mixed fores t - 162,87 949,63Trans i tiona l fores t - 4,59 62,70Moors and heathland - 35,00 621,04Natura l gras s land - 7,35 1036,43
Fire Damage Grading Levels
Tota l a ffected area (ha): 4284,20
